Traditional Funeral Services A traditional funeral service is when
your loved one is present. Generally visitation is held the day or night
before the funeral. The funeral service itself is held either in our
funeral home, a church or other location, followed by a procession to the
cemetery for a committal service, or if cremated, the deceased is returned
to the funeral home.
Basic Services
Our basic services include, but are not limited to:
- Staff and facilities necessary to respond to initial
service request.
- Sheltering of remains.
- Gather personal information for, and assist family
with, newspaper and radio obituary.
- Preparation and filing of necessary
permits and authorization relating to the death and burial or cremation.
- Consultation with the
family or other responsible party to determine services desired.
- Ascertain times for visitation and arrange staffing
for greeting family and friends. (Greeters are necessary to direct people
and assist them with questions they may have.)
- Arrange location for services such as funeral home,
church or other setting for the service selected. (We have held
services in our families' backyard, local civic center, reception halls,
fraternal clubhouse, etc.)
-
Contact officiate, fraternal groups, veterans, musicians, etc.
-
Arrange floral arrangements.
- Coordinating the details with the cemetery,
crematory, and/or other parties responsible for the final disposition of the deceased.
- Supervision of transfer to cemetery, or
airport.
Embalming
and Other Preparation of the Body The embalming process includes preparation and
sanitary care to ensure disinfection and preservation. Embalming requires
specialized facilities and equipment. Other preparation of the body includes
bathing, shaving, dressing, cosmetizing and casketing.
